About Aurelie Marsac
Aurelie Marsac is a Purchasing Category Manager specializing in Plastic Injection, Tubes, and Wood at Groupe Rocher since 2019. She has extensive experience in purchasing and project management, having previously held various roles at Groupe Rocher and worked as a Buyer at Groupe Beaumanoir.
Current Role at Groupe Rocher
Aurelie Marsac serves as the Purchasing Category Manager for Plastic Injection, Tubes, and Wood at Groupe Rocher. She has held this position since 2019, contributing to the company's procurement strategies and supplier management in La Gacilly. Her role involves overseeing the purchasing process for specific materials, ensuring quality and cost-effectiveness.
Previous Experience at Groupe Rocher
Prior to her current role, Aurelie Marsac held multiple positions at Groupe Rocher. She worked as a Project Development Manager from 2008 to 2011, followed by her role as Project Buyer for Packaging from 2011 to 2013. She then transitioned to Purchasing Category Manager for Plastic Injection and Metal from 2015 to 2019, and for Printing and Cardboard from 2013 to 2015.
Experience at Groupe Beaumanoir
Before joining Groupe Rocher, Aurelie Marsac worked at Groupe Beaumanoir as a Buyer in the Marketing and Retail sector. She held this position for three years from 2005 to 2008 in Saint Malo, where she was involved in procurement activities related to marketing and retail operations.
Educational Background
Aurelie Marsac studied at Université de Rennes I, where she earned a Master of Business Management from 1999 to 2004. She furthered her education at Université de Nantes, IAE, achieving a Master of Innovative Project Management and Entrepreneurship from 2004 to 2005.
